Principal Software Engineer, B2b Engineering

OpenAI OpenAI · AI Frontier · United States · Remote · Applied AI

Principal Software Engineer to design and scale backend systems, APIs, and infrastructure for OpenAI's developer and enterprise-facing AI products. Focus on distributed systems, data pipelines, security, compliance, and reliability for global scale.

What you'd actually do

  1. Design, build, and scale the backend services, APIs, and infrastructure that power OpenAI’s developer and enterprise products
  2. Lead the architecture of distributed systems, databases, and data pipelines that support large-scale, high-reliability production workloads
  3. Own major platform capabilities end-to-end, from early technical strategy and design through implementation, launch, and long-term operation
  4. Shape the design of our APIs with care and intentionality, treating API interfaces as core product surfaces and driving a high-quality developer experience
  5. Build secure, reliable, and compliant systems that meet the needs of both enterprise and developer use cases

Skills

Required

  • Python
  • Go
  • Rust
  • TypeScript
  • distributed systems
  • API design
  • backend systems
  • production backend systems
  • software engineering fundamentals

Nice to have

  • founder or early engineer at a startup
  • built products and platforms from scratch

What the JD emphasized

  • high bar for performance, safety, reliability, and API design
  • high bar for developer experience and interface design
  • significant experience building, scaling, and evolving production backend systems
  • deep expertise in software engineering fundamentals, distributed systems, and API design
  • track record of leading complex technical initiatives and driving architecture across teams or critical product areas
  • Care deeply about reliability, safety, security, and performance in production environments
  • strong product instincts and a high bar for developer experience and interface design